A solitary rider glides his mount through the shallows of a stream. He leads a pack horse. He has entered the territory of hostile Native Americans. A feeling of apprehension and a sense of foreboding sweep over him. He studies the trees as they grow denser and press ever closer. It's as though the "Forest Has Eyes." - BD

To the Plains Indian, the buffalo meant survival, food, shelter and clothing. The buffalo was a migratory animal, constantly on the move searching for forage and water. To hunt the herds in enemy territory meant danger as well as a long haul back to camp with hides and meat. However, the powerful magic of the Shaman could call to the spirits of the buffalo. -BD
